Procrastination is caused because we fear failure. Following your dreams and goals is discomforting; getting where you want takes time and hard work. As the brain tends to fear potential failure, it prefers tasks that are more comfortable and easier to do, like scrolling through social media or checking e-mails, because, for one part, it’s entertainment which makes us feel good. Also, it reduces stress and the fear of missing out on something important.

It would be best if you stopped seeing fear as a negative emotion so you can benefit from your fears. Fear arises with the threat of physical, emotional, or psychological harm, real or imagined. While traditionally considered a “negative” emotion, fear is essential in keeping us safe as it mobilises us to cope with potential danger. A little bit of fear is standard. Fear helps you instinctively protect yourself from harm. Your fear might help you to recognise when you are about to do something dangerous, and it could help you to make a safer choice.
